The Blizzard team has no plans to change the situation. balance of heroes from Overwatch 2 until the beginning Season 2It will begin on December 6th. In a post on the game’s official website, the developers explained that they are currently happy with the balance between the various characters and are currently considering possible changes for the upcoming season.
“While some heroes perform better than others and there are differences between player skill levels, we’re happy to see that no hero’s overall strength level has strayed far from our goals,” Blizzard’s post says.
“Each hero on the roster has a 45% to 55% win rate, and we are not planning any immediate balance changes based on what we see, except for a targeted change in Total Mayhem mode for Zarya. It plans to make a series of balance changes in line with our development goal of ensuring the overall game is balanced and balanced for the season to create a more distinct identity.”
The idea of not making balance changes right away seems plausible, given the hero win rate the developers have stated. After all, many budding users have yet to learn how to use Overwatch 2’s more than thirty heroes, older players probably need to be familiar with the gameplay changes in this new iteration. In such a scenario, buffing or nerfing can even be harmful.
